Mary H. Gibbon: teamwork of the heart.
Mary Maly Hopkinson Gibbon was born on September 25, 1903, to an affluent New England family who encouraged her to embrace her intelligence and to follow that by which she was intrigued. In doing this, Maly pursued work in scientific research, where she ultimately met her first husband, Dr. John ‘‘Jack’’ H. Gibbon. Jack and Maly were partners in every sense of the word. Their collaboration, both within and beyond the walls of the research laboratory, made it possible for the Gibbon dream of the heart–lung machine to be realized
An Exploration of Modes in Polyphonic Compositions of the Sixteenth Century
Modes in the Renaissance era were vital to understand the inner workings of a piece. Modal theory implies every Renaissance composition should have a distinct mode in which it belongs. The mode of any piece from this era is theoretically obvious by the first or last note of the piece as well as the range given, but researchers have argued the validity of this claim. Complications arise in the case of pieces with two or more voices. Polyphonic music causes uncertainty regarding the method of identifying the mode of a piece. This paper will look deeply at the Missa Papae Marcelli by Giovanni Pierluigi da Palestrina in an attempt to decipher the process used to find the mode in polyphonic music. The Missa Papae Marcelli is a work scored for six independent voices, with some movements being reduced to only four voices. Analysis of this piece will be done to prove that a mode can be established in polyphonic works, and to explain the validity of modal theory in deeply complex, polyphonic musical structures
Precision metering of microliter volumes of biological fluids in micro-gravity
Concepts were demonstrated and investigated for transferring accurately known and reproducible microliter volumes of biological fluids from sample container onto dry chemistry slides in microgravity environment. Specific liquid transfer tip designs were compared. Information was obtained for design of a liquid sample handling system to enable clinical chemical analysis in microgravity. Disposable pipet tips and pipet devices that were designed to transfer microliter volumes of biological fluid from a (test tube) sample container in 1-G environment were used during microgravity periods of parabolic trajectories of the KC-135 aircraft. The transfer process was recorded using charge coupled device camera and video cassette equipment. Metering behavior of water, a synthetic aqueous protein solution, and anticoagulated human blood was compared. Transfer of these liquids to 2 substrate materials representative of rapidly wettable and slowly wettable dry chemistry slide surface was compared
Nomenclatural Changes for Some Grasses in California. II.
Two additional nomenclatural changes are required for Poaceae treatments that will appear in the second edition of The Jepson Manual: Higher Plants of California. They are Elymus x gouldii and Festuca temulenta. The former corrects a violation of the rule in the International Code of Botanical Nomenclature involving the naming of hybrids, and the latter involves a widely occurring non-native grass in California traditionally assigned to Lolium
The Chromosome Number of Schaffnerella Gracilis (Gramineae, Chloridoideae)
The first ever chromosome report for the monotypic genus Schaffnerella (Grarnineae, Chloridoideae) is 2n = 20 (10 II) from pollen parent cells at diakinesis, which indicates diploidy and a base number of 10. The close relative Lycurus likewise has x = 10, but is tetraploid (2n = 4x = 40)
Phylogenetics of Andropogoneae (Poaceae: Panicoideae) Based on Nuclear Ribosomal Internal Transcribed Spacer and Chloroplast trnL–F Sequences
Phylogenetic relationships among 85 species representing 35 genera in the grass tribe Andropogoneae were estimated from maximum parsimony and Bayesian analyses of nuclear ITS and chloroplast trnL–F DNA sequences. Ten of the 11 subtribes recognized by Clayton and Renvoize (1986) were sampled. Independent analyses of ITS and trnL–F yielded mostly congruent, though not well resolved, topologies. Arundinella is sister to Andropogoneae in the trnL–F phylogeny and is nested within the tribe in the ITS and combined data trees. Tristachya is sister to Andropogoneae + Arundinella in the ITS phylogeny. Four clades are common to the ITS and trnL–F phylogenies and the trees from the combined data set. Clade A consists of Andropogon, Diectomis, Hyparrhenia, Hyperthelia, and Schizachyrium. Within this clade, Andropogon distachyos, Hyparrhenia, and Hyperthelia form clade C. Clade B consists of Bothriochloa, Capillipedium, and Dichanthium, and clade D includes Chrysopogon and Vetiveria. Analysis of the combined data resulted in an unsupported larger clade comprising clades A and B plus Cymbopogon, and a sister clade of Heteropogon, Iseilema, and Themeda. This larger clade is similar to the core Andropogoneae clade previously reported (Spangler et al. 1999; Mathews et al. 2002). Based on our sample, which represents 41% of the tribe’s genera, most of Clayton and Renvoize’s (1986) subtribes are not monophyletic
